facility (s) (noun), facilities (pl)
1. A space or equipment necessary for doing something: The sports facility in Monica's town is quite good because it includes an indoor swimming pool, a sauna, and tennis courts.
2. An establishment set up to fulfill a particular function or to provide a particular service: Normally medicalĀ facilities are available in most places so people can go there to see a doctor about their illnesses or injuries.
3. The capability to do or to learn something very skilfully and easily; a natural talent or gift: After practicing the piano for just a week, Mildred showed her facility of playing a variety of musical performances for her teacher and classmates.
An easy way of doing something with skill.
